What is Server Colocation?
Server colocation is an innovative hosting service that allows businesses to house their own servers in professional data center facilities. Simply put, server colocation is a server custody service. Think of it like renting a room in a five-star hotel for your computer. You bring your 'guests' (servers), and the hotel (data center) provides all the top class amenities - electricity, air conditioning, security and super fast internet connection.
In contrast to cloud hosting service or dedicated server service where you use the provider's own hardware, with colocation, you have complete control over the hardware specifications and configuration. This gives you maximum flexibility to meet your specific business needs.
How Server Colocation Works
The server colocation process is similar to leaving your luxury car in an exclusive parking lot. Here's how it works:
- You purchase and configure the server as needed.
- The server is shipped and installed in a special rack in the provider's data center.
- The provider connects the server to electricity, cooling systems, and the internet network.
- You can access and manage the server remotely, or visit the data center if necessary.
The provider keeps this 'parking lot' always in optimal condition - maintained temperature, stable electricity, fast internet connection, and 24/7 security. Meanwhile, you still have the 'keys' to access and manage the contents of your 'car' (server) at any time.

Challenges in Using Colocation Servers
- Initial Investment: Purchasing servers and supporting equipment can require large capital. It's like buying a luxury car - expensive up front, but can be profitable in the long run.
- Technical Expertise: You need a reliable IT team to manage the server. It's not like driving an automatic car, but more like piloting a jet plane - it requires special skills.
- Location Dependency: Physical access is limited to the data center location. If there is a hardware problem, you may need to visit the data center or rely on "remote hands" from provider staff.

Types of Colocation Servers
Colocation servers can be categorized based on several aspects, such as size, location in the data center, and level of service provided. Here are some common types of server colocation:
- Single Server Colocation:
- Description: Provides space for one physical server. Suitable for small businesses or companies just starting out with colocation.
- Advantages: Lower costs and easier to manage.
- Limitations: Limited scalability; less than ideal for fast growth.
- Rack Space Colocation:
- Description: Provides space in the form of a rack that can accommodate several servers. Flexible for businesses that need more servers.
- Advantages: Easy to increase or decrease the number of servers as needed.
- Limitations: Requires more complex management than a single server.
- Cage Colocation:
- Description: Provides a safer and more isolated physical space, usually in the form of a private cage within the data center.
- Advantages: Higher physical security and greater control over the server environment.
- Limitations: Higher cost compared to rack space.
- Dedicated Suite Colocation:
- Description: Provides exclusive space for one company, often including larger areas and special facilities.
- Advantages: ControlFull top hosting environment and the ability to customize the infrastructure as needed.
- Limitations: Highest cost among colocation types.
- Managed Colocation:
- Description: In addition to providing physical space, the provider also offers server management services such as monitoring, maintenance, and technical support.
- Advantages: Reduces operational burden for companies that do not have a strong IT team.
- Limitations: Additional fees for management services.

Important Features in Colocation Services
When choosing a server colocation service in Indonesia, pay attention to:
- Rack Specifications: Make sure the rack size fits your server. Ask about load capacity and options for future expansion.
- Electrical Power: Check the electrical capacity per rack and the availability of UPS (Uninterruptible Power Supply). Some providers offer N+1 or 2N redundancy options for maximum reliability.
- Cooling: Ask about the cooling system used. Modern data centers often use efficient cooling technologies such as cold aisle containment.
- Connectivity: Check the connection speeds offered and options for multiple carriers. Some providers even offer direct connections to Internet Exchange Points.
- Security: Ask about physical (guards, CCTV, access control) and digital (firewalls, IDS/IPS) security systems.
- Support: Make sure there is technical staff available 24/7. Ask about "remote hands" services to help with hardware problems.
How to Choose a Colocation Server Provider
Consider the following factors:
- Location: Choose a strategic data center - close to your business or target market. Location also affects network latency.
- Certification: Check whether the data center has certification such as Tier III or IV, or ISO 27001 for information security.
- Reputation: Read customer reviews and ask for references. Check the provider's track record in terms of uptime and problem handling.

Steps to Implement Colocation Server
- Requirements analysis: Evaluate your computing, storage, and networking needs. Consider growth projections for the next 3-5 years.
- Select and purchase hardware: Invest in a high-quality server that suits your needs. Consider redundancy for critical components.
- Provider selection: Do due diligence on several providers. Visit a data center if possible.
- Software preparation: Install and configure the operating system, applications, and security settings before shipping.
- Delivery and installation: Pack the server safely and send it to the data center. Many providers offer installation services.
- Network configuration: Once the server is installed, configure the network and firewall settings.
- Testing: Perform thorough testing to ensure all systems are working as they should.
- Go-live and monitoring: Once everything is running smoothly, start migrating production workloads. Monitor performance closely in the beginning.
FAQ about Server Colocation
Q: What is the main difference between a colocation server and a dedicated server?
In colocation, you own your own hardware and place it in the provider's data center. With a dedicated server, you rent the entire server from the provider. Colocation gives you more control over hardware specifications.
Q: Is server colocation cheap?
Although the initial investment is higher because you need to purchase hardware, colocation can be more economical in the long term for high and consistent computing needs. Operational costs such as electricity and cooling are usually more efficient in large data centers.
Q: What about security on colocation servers?
Colocation data centers generally have multi-layered security systems, both physical (guards, CCTV, biometric access control) and digital (sophisticated firewalls, intrusion detection systems). However, software and data security remains your responsibility.
Q: Can I access my server at any time?
Most colocation providers offer 24/7 access to your server, either remotely or physically (by appointment). However, security procedures may require prior notification for physical visits.
Q: What if I need to increase capacity?
Most colocation providers allow you to add or upgrade servers easily. You can add racks or upgrade existing server specifications. Be sure to discuss your growth plans with your provider.
